CMI has an Administrative and AR Specialist opportunity available in Lansdale PA.

This position is 100% onsite and part time working 3 days per week; 8 hours per day.

What your daily responsibilities look like:

  • Provide general administrative support: handle incoming calls process incoming and outgoing mail/shipments maintain office cleanliness coordinate with facility manager schedule meetings coordinate catering
  • Monitor accounts receivable aging reports and track overdue balances.
  • Conduct collection efforts with customers via email and phone.
  • Resolve customer billing disputes and coordinate with internal departments as needed.
  • Escalate delinquent accounts according to company policy.
  • Maintain accurate customer account records and documentation.
  • Prepare AR reports including aging reports and collection status.
  • Setup on-going meetings with executive team to update progress on AR.
  • Place inventory orders for office supplies and equipment.
  • Help to maintain timesheet information for specific employees.
  • Create and distribute training cards and certificates.
  • Maintain vehicles and appointments and monitor usage.
  • Prepare outgoing reports for delivery.
  • Process equipment testing.
  • Facilitate and maintain badges quarterly.
  • Edit/format documents as needed.
  • Order business cards as needed.
  • Distribute internal notifications and recognitions.
  • Assist employees with travel booking hotels flights car rentals as needed.
  • Occasional travel to get lunch supplies and deliver equipment.

What you need to succeed in this role:

  • 3 years experience in AR
  • 1-3 years experience in an administrative capacity.
  • Deltek Vantagepoint experience a plus.
  • Be onsite 3 days per week in Lansdale PA. A minium of 24 hours per week.
  • Organized friendly and be able to handle difficult situations with professionalism.
  • Experience using MS Software and Adobe.
  • Solid proof-reading skills and attention to detail.
  • Be able to multi-task and change direction based on priorities.
